    qemu: Don't assume secret provided for LUKS encryption · 7f7d9904
    John Ferlan 提交于
    https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1405269
    
    If a secret was not provided for what was determined to be a LUKS
    encrypted disk (during virStorageFileGetMetadata processing when
    called from qemuDomainDetermineDiskChain as a result of hotplug
    attach qemuDomainAttachDeviceDiskLive), then do not attempt to
    look it up (avoiding a libvirtd crash) and do not alter the format
    to "luks" when adding the disk; otherwise, the device_add would
    fail with a message such as:
    
       "unable to execute QEMU command 'device_add': Property 'scsi-hd.drive'
        can't find value 'drive-scsi0-0-0-0'"
    
    because of assumptions that when the format=luks that libvirt would have
    provided the secret to decrypt the volume.
    
    Access to unlock the volume will thus be left to the application.
